What are Foot Veins?

Foot veins play an essential role in circulation, carrying blood from the feet back to the heart against gravity. This process relies on small one-way valves inside the veins that keep blood moving in the correct direction. When these valves weaken or become damaged, blood can begin to pool in the veins instead of flowing efficiently.

Over time, this can lead to visible vein changes, swelling, discomfort, and other symptoms in the feet and ankles.

Why Foot Veins Matter

Foot vein issues are more than just a visual concern—they can be an indication of underlying venous insufficiency, a condition where blood does not flow properly back toward the heart. Addressing these concerns early can help prevent progression and improve overall vascular health.
